    Abstract: An electrode of a chemical cell includes a substrate having a surface, an array of conductive projections supported by the substrate and extending outward from the surface of the substrate, each conductive projection of the array of conductive projections having a semiconductor composition for reduction of carbon dioxide (CO2) in the chemical cell, and a catalyst arrangement disposed along each conductive projection of the array of conductive projections, the catalyst arrangement including a copper-based catalyst and an iron-based catalyst for the reduction of carbon dioxide (CO2) in the chemical cell.

    Abstract: A computer-implemented method is presented for determining sampling rate for at least one of a camera and a receiver of a global navigation satellite system deployed in an autonomous vehicle. A Kalman filter is used for predicting a local sampling rate for the camera and a global sampling rate for the receiver in the global navigation satellite system. The method includes: retrieving length of the lane being traversed by the autonomous vehicle from a graph, where nodes of the graph represent intersection in a road network and edges of the graph represent paths in the road network; measuring speed of the autonomous vehicle as it traverses the lane; estimating the local sampling rate and the global sampling rate using the measured speed and the Kalman filter; and capturing, by the camera, images in accordance with the local sampling rate estimated by the Kalman filter.

    Abstract: A method of estimating lung motion includes collecting multiple ultrasound image data captured at one or more locations of a sample region of tissue. The method further includes comparing the multiple ultrasound image data and determining temporal correlation coefficients between each of the multiple ultrasound image data. The method still further includes displaying an image of the sample region of the tissue with the temporal correlation coefficients identified, thereby indicating lung motion. In further methods, the determined temporal correlation coefficients are used to determine an amount of decorrelation, which can be used to determine strain of the tissue over the sample region and to calculate lung displacements and lung shape changes representing ventilation.

    Abstract: Printable cementitious compositions for additive manufacturing are provided, that have a fresh state and a hardened state. In fresh state, the composition is flowable and extrudable in the additive manufacturing process. In the hardened state, the composition exhibits strain hardening. In one variation, the strain hardening is represented by a uniaxial tensile strength of ?about 2.5 MPa, a tensile strain capacity of ?about 1%, and a compressive strength at 100 hours of ?about 20 MPa. In other variations, the composition includes Portland cement, a calcium aluminate cement, a fine aggregate, water, a high range water reducing agent (HRWRA), and a polymeric fiber, as well as one or more optional components selected from: fly ash, silica flour, microsilica, attapulgite nanoclay, and/or hydroxypropylmethyl cellulose (HPMC). Methods of additive manufacturing with such compositions are also provided.

    Abstract: The disclosure relates to bioreactors, for example for biological treatment and, more specifically to bioreactor insert apparatus including biofilms and related methods. The bioreactor insert apparatus provides a means for circulation of reaction medium within the bioreactor, a biofilm support, and biological treatment of an inlet feed to die reactor/insert apparatus. The bioreactor insert apparatus has a high relative surface area for biofilm attachment and is capable of generating complex flow patterns and increasing treatment efficiency/biological conversion activity in a biologically-active reactor. The high surface area structure incorporates multiple biofilm support structures such as meshes at inlet and outlet portions of the structure. The biofilm support structures and biofilms thereon can increase overall reaction rate of the bioreactor and/or perform some solid/liquid separation in the treatment of the wastewater or other influent.

    Abstract: An engineered cementitious composite (ECC) has a tensile strain capacity ranging from 8.6 to 12.5% and includes a cement precursor, unprocessed desert sand, and polymer fibers. The polymer fibers may be ultra-high molecular weight polyethylene fibers, polypropylene fibers, or a combination thereof. A method of preparing an ECC structure includes providing a cementitious precursor mixture including a cement precursor and unprocessed desert sand, introducing water into the cementitious precursor mixture to form a cement slurry, and adding polymer fibers to the cement slurry. The polymer fibers may be ultra-high molecular weight polyethylene fibers, polypropylene fibers, or a combination thereof. Then, the method includes forming a structure with the cement slurry and curing the cement slurry.

    Abstract: Methods of forming a structural color metal-dielectric-metal (MDM) component via a solution-based process are provided. First, a first metal layer is formed over a treated surface of a substrate by a first electroless deposition process. A surface of the treated substrate is contacted with a first plating bath that comprises a metal selected from the group consisting of: copper, aluminum, silver, alloys, and combinations thereof. A dielectric layer, for example, comprising silicon dioxide, is then deposited over the first metal layer by a sol-gel process. Next, the method comprises forming a second metal layer over the dielectric layer by a second electroless deposition process by contacting the dielectric layer with a second plating bath having a neutral pH and comprising a metal selected from the group consisting of: copper, aluminum, silver, alloys, and combinations thereof.

    Abstract: An anti-icing coating is provided having low interfacial toughness (LIT) with ice. The anti-icing coating includes a polymer and a plasticizing agent. A thickness of the anti-icing coating may be less than or equal to about 100 micrometers (?m). Further, the anti-icing coating has an interfacial toughness (?ice) with ice of less than or equal to about 1 J/m2. Such an anti-icing coating may be applied to a substrate or surface of a device on which ice may form, such as aircraft, vehicles, marine vessels, outdoor equipment, snow or ice removal equipment, recreational equipment, wind turbines, telecommunications equipment, power lines, and the like. Methods of forming such anti-icing coatings are also provided.
